A new classification of molar furcation involvement based on the root trunk and horizontal and vertical bone loss
1Graduate Institute of Dental Sciences and Periodontics, Kaohsiung Medical College School of Dentistry, Taiwan, Republic of China.
Abstract:
This study presents a new classification of molar furcation involvement based on the root trunk and horizontal and vertical attachments, and relates them to guidelines in diagnosis, prognosis, and treatment of molar furcation involvements. The type of root trunk were classified on the basis of the ratio of vertical dimension of root trunk to root length as types A, B, and C. Based on the results of this study, the authors conclude that consideration of the root trunk type as well as the horizontal and vertical attachment loss in the classification of molar furcation involvements may facilitate prognosis, diagnosis, and treatment planning.

Tooth Anatomy
The Crown, Neck, and Root
The visible part of the tooth is referred to as the crown. It's covered by enamel, the hardest substance in the human body. The crown is uniquely shaped for each type of tooth, allowing for different functions such as cutting, tearing, or grinding food.
